Not necessarily. We’re tool-agnostic. We start by auditing your current stack (e.g., Google Workspace/Microsoft 365, Slack/Teams, ClickUp/Asana, CRM, e-signature, billing, storage) and keep what’s working.

If we recommend a change, it’s because it reduces friction, eliminates duplicate work, or improves reliability. When a switch makes sense, we plan a phased migration (pilot → parallel run → full cutover) with backups and rollback options to minimize disruption.

It depends on scope and decision speed, but here are honest ranges:

  • Audit + quick wins: 1–2 weeks

  • Single pipeline (e.g., sales or onboarding): 2–4 weeks

  • Multi-team process (sales→ops→finance): 4–8 weeks

  • Org-wide redesign: 8–12+ weeks (phased rollout)
    Timelines are influenced by tool access, content/readiness, and stakeholder availability. We favor incremental delivery so you see value early and often.
